Wine - это уровень совместимости, позволяющий запускать приложения Windows на нескольких POSIX-совместимых операционных системах, таких как Linux, MacOS и BSD. Вместо того, чтобы имитировать внутреннюю логику Windows, такую как виртуальная машина или эмулятор, Wine переводит вызовы Windows API в вызовы POSIX на лету, устраняя потери производительности и памяти других методов и позволяя аккуратно интегрировать приложения Windows в рабочий стол.
Команда Wine подготовила новый релиз с некоторыми исправлениями и улучшениями.
Что нового:
- Данные Unicode обновлены до версии Unicode 13.
- Встроенные программы используют новую среду выполнения UCRTBase C.
- Более правильная поддержка интернационализированных доменных имен.
- Поддержка отрисовки прямоугольников с закругленными углами в Direct2D.
- Отрисовка текста в D3DX9.
Последнее нововведение исправляет ошибку, которая была открыта еще в 2010 году, когда во многих играх не было текстового рендеринга. Однако, не гарантируется работа во всех играх, так как это "очень базовая реализация ID3DXFont_DrawText."
Было отмечено 34 решенных ошибки. В этот список попали игры: NIeR: Automata, Divinity Original Sin 2, Final Fantasy V, BioShock 2, Assassin's Creed.
Более подробную информацию можно узнать здесь.